What Are The Features Of A25-30XNT Forklift Models?

The Toyota A25-30XNT forklifts are 2.5–3.0-ton electric models featuring AC drive motors, regenerative braking, and optional lithium-ion or hydrogen fuel cell power. Key features include a low center of gravity for stability, operator presence sensing (OPS), and ergonomic controls. Lithium-ion variants achieve full charges in 1–2 hours, with 8-hour runtime, ideal for high-demand logistics. Pro Tip: Always use OEM-specified chargers to prevent battery degradation.

What load capacities do A25-30XNT forklifts handle?

The A25-30XNT series supports 2,500–3,000 kg, optimized for medium-duty pallet handling. Stability is ensured via a reinforced chassis and 500–600mm load centers. Higher capacities require dual front tires or counterweight adjustments. Pro Tip: Exceeding rated loads trips the OPS sensor—keep within 90% capacity for inclines.

These forklifts use high-torque AC motors generating 12–15 kW, paired with 48V or 80V electrical systems. The load capacity depends on mast type: duplex (7m lift) reduces max weight by 10% versus simplex. For example, a 3,000kg load on a simplex mast drops to 2,700kg with duplex. Transitioning to real-world use, think of moving automotive parts in a warehouse—overloading risks mast deflection. But how does the chassis design counteract this? The monocoque frame redistributes stress, while the rear axle’s mechanical auto-braking prevents tipping. Always check load center labels—misplaced pallets reduce effective capacity by 20–30%.

How do power systems affect A25-30XNT performance?

The A25-30XNT offers lead-acid, Li-ion, or hydrogen options. Li-ion cuts charging time by 70% vs. lead-acid, with 2,000+ cycles. Hydrogen models reach 10-minute refuels but require infrastructure. Pro Tip: Li-ion retains 80% capacity after 5 years if kept at 20–25°C.

Electric drivetrains use 48V/600Ah lead-acid or 80V/400Ah Li-ion packs. Hydrogen fuel cells generate 15kW continuous, but cold climates reduce output by 12–15%. Consider this: a 3-shift warehouse using Li-ion saves 300 hours annually vs. lead-acid charging. However, hydrogen’s appeal lies in zero local emissions—perfect for food/pharma sectors. What’s the trade-off? Upfront costs: Li-ion costs 2x lead-acid, hydrogen 3x. Still, total ownership costs drop 25% with Li-ion due to lower maintenance. Transitioning between power types, always verify compatibility—retrofitting hydrogen systems needs chassis reinforcement.

What safety technologies are integrated?

The A25-30XNT includes OPS, automatic braking, and LED floodlights. The OPS halts movement if the operator leaves the seat, while curve control limits speed by 30% during turns. Pro Tip: Test the emergency reverse cutoff monthly—faulty sensors cause 15% of accidents.

⚠️ Warning: Never bypass the OPS—bypassed systems account for 40% of tip-over fatalities.

Advanced models add radar-based collision detection (3m range) and blue safety lights projecting a 2m perimeter. For instance, in busy ports, the collision system reduces side-impact risks by 60%. How does braking adapt to loads? The electrohydraulic system adjusts pressure based on load weight—3,000kg loads trigger 20% faster brake response. Additionally, the mast’s tilt-in-motion feature prevents load spillage during height changes. Practically speaking, pairing these features with trained operators reduces incident rates by 90%.

How does ergonomic design enhance operator comfort?

The A25-30XNT features a suspended seat, adjustable armrests, and a 10° steering wheel tilt. The multi-function LCD displays battery health and fault codes. Pro Tip: Use the auto-return seat function—after 3 seconds idle, it resets to entry position.

Operators enjoy 360° visibility via a low-profile overhead guard and convex mirrors. The hydrostatic transmission eliminates gear shifts, reducing fatigue during 8-hour shifts. Think of it like driving a modern car versus a manual truck—smoother acceleration, precise control. But what about noise? The AC motor operates at <65 dB, critical for indoor use. A comparative study showed 30% fewer complaints about leg strain versus older models. Adjustable pedals and fingertip hydraulic controls further minimize repetitive motion injuries. If you’re managing a fleet, prioritize models with air-ride seats—they reduce lower back pain claims by 50%.
